The Certified Senior Advisor (CSA) certification, offered by the Society of Certified Senior Advisors (SCSA), is a highly respected credential for professionals working with older adults. It equips individuals with the knowledge and ethical framework necessary to address the unique financial, healthcare, social, and personal needs of seniors. Earning the CSA designation demonstrates a professional’s commitment to providing top-tier service and support to the aging population.
